JCharged, you're running an 11:1 3.5-S, isnt that right?
Correct sir. Now I plan to have a custom Intake manifold setup in a few months. I figured I could take the top end apart, have the heads milled and leave the gaskets intact. that will increase my overall static compression slightly.

While I'm at it I plan to add the blockguard and upgrade valvetrain. Richie's harness makes for the rev limit to be a little higher. Not sure if gains are to be had with just a stock ECU but I'm sure with tuning...we could finally have some fun. Also makes for some nice insurance with the upgraded parts.

I am still trying to afford a standalone. I think it will be much less heartache to go with that rather than tooling with the e-manage and FIC.

Now that the tuning is becoming more supportive, I hope you can get a jumpstart on the rebuild. I wish I could turn back and start all over sometimes. It is a nice OEM upgrade but I'm just not happy with the money I've spent on it. Should've waited and got the crank knife-edged/balanced, block hottanked, bore 0.5 over, have the rods shotpeened and etc.
